Sui.

Допис

Діліться своїми знаннями.

article banner.
HaGiang.
May 25, 2025
Стаття

Моя перша стаття zKat: Аутентифікація збереження конфіденційності для публічних блокчейнів

Тому що прозорість не повинна означати відмову від своїх секретів.

На більшості публічних блокчейнів сьогодні кожна транзакція та ідентичність користувача є загальнодоступними. Хоча прозорість є однією з найбільших сильних сторін блокчейну, вона коштує конфіденційності, особливо коли мова йде про аутентифікацію.

zKAT скорочення від автентифікаторів з нульовим знанням — це новий криптографічний примітив, який приносить автентифікацію, що зберігає конфіденційність, у світ блокчейнів. За допомогою ZKat користувачі можуть довести, що вони уповноважені здійснювати транзакцію, не розкриваючи правил або політики, що стоять за цією авторизацією.

##Проблема традиційних підходів

Попередні спроби конфіденційності при аутентифікації, такі як використанняпорогових підпису, могли приховати лише обмежену інформацію.

Наприклад, вони можуть приховати, які користувачі підписали транзакцію, але не багато іншого. Вони також боролися з більш складними політиками автентифікації**(наприклад, комбінації ролей, ідентифікацій або правил).

ZKat змінює гру:

  • Підтримкадовільно складноїполітики
  • Дозволяє гнучкі структури, яккомбінації підписів із кількома схемами
  • Зберіганнявсієї політики прихованоювід громадськості

##Як працює ZKat

Для створення zKat автори розробиликомпілятор, який перетворює широко використовувану системуGroth16Zk-SNARK у новий тип доказуНеінтерактивного нульового знання (NIZK) - той, який підтримуєеквівалентні ключі верифікації.

Що це означає?

Це означає, що верифікаторне може розповіти, яка політика використовується, але доказ все ще переконує їх у тому, що вона дійсна. Це абсолютно нова криптографічна властивість, представлена в статті, і це основа того, як ZKat забезпечуєконфіденційність політики.

Але автори не зупинилися на ZKat. Вони пішли на крок далі зZKAT, версією, яка підтримуєнепомітні оновлення.

Коротше кажучи:

Видавець політики може оновити політику автентифікації не розкриваючи нічого новего

Це надзвичайно потужно в реальних блокчейн-системах, де політика може знадобитися еволюціонувати - подумайте про DAO, що оновлюють правила голосування, або установи, що обертають ключі. Вони також досліджують використаннярекурсивних zk-доказів, щоб зробити ZKat+ масштабованим та придатним для інтеграції з блокчейном.

Дослідники реалізували zKAT в прототип для автентифікації на основі порогових показників. Їх оцінка показує:

  • Продуктивність нарівні з традиційними пороговими підписами
  • ZKat підтримуєнабагато складнішу політику
  • Все це, змінімальними витратами
  • Sui
  • Architecture
1
Поділитися
Коментарі
.

Sui is a Layer 1 protocol blockchain designed as the first internet-scale programmable blockchain platform.

306Пости450Відповіді
Sui.X.Peera.

Зароби свою частку з 1000 Sui

Заробляй бали репутації та отримуй винагороди за допомогу в розвитку спільноти Sui.

Кампанія винагородЧервень
Ми використовуємо файли cookie, щоб гарантувати вам найкращий досвід на нашому сайті.
Детальніше